Ted Cruz will have to answer for own Rev. Wright and dodging the question won’t cut it
Coach is Right ^ | 01/07/16 | Kevin "Coach" Collins

Posted on 01/07/2016 9:10:59 AM PST by Oldpuppymax

Ted Cruz has associated himself with a man who says the Catholic Church supports pedophilia; and Christians should execute homosexuals. If Cruz becomes the Republican nominee this would destroy any chance he might have of defeating Hillary Clinton. If this doesn’t stir his supporters to think twice, it ought to.

On Friday, November 6, 2015 Cruz attended a campaign rally in Des Moines, Iowa, hosted by a Colorado pastor who frequently calls for putting gay people to death. The Pastor, Kevin Swanson, is well known for calling for Christians to execute homosexuals just the same as the Islamists do and Hitler’s Nazi Germany did. Pastor Swanson has accused the Catholic Church of wanting to “legitimize” child molestation saying, “The Catholic Church will never be able to legitimize pederasty.”

This is Rev. Jeremiah Wright type hate.

When asked how he could attend a rally coordinated by Pastor Swanson, Cruz told ABC News: “Listen, I don’t know what this gentleman has said or hasn’t said. I know that when it comes to religious liberty, this is a passion of mine and has been for decades and that I have been fighting for religious liberty for everyone.” Thinking this would be the end of this matter is delusional.

Cruz knew exactly who Pastor Swanson is and what he is all about, but denied any knowledge of the man’s past statements. For a man who is as careful with his words as Cruz, this is very hard to believe. For a Republican presidential candidate this would be a major problem.

Swanson has been calling for the execution of gays...
